Ammunition, missiles and other explosive weapons
Expected Impact: The results of the activities should contribute to support common procurement, leading to strengthening the cooperation among Member States and associated countries, as well as to greater interoperability. Furthermore, they should contribute to the building up of strategic stockpile of ammunition, missiles, including their components, or to the increase of existing ones, as well as to the development of low-cost unmanned systems for guided strikes adapted to modern warfare scenarios. Objective: This topic aims at actions supporting the common procurement of ammunition (including small arms ammunition, tank and anti-tank ammunitions, artillery ammunition, guided ammunitions), missiles (all types of missiles) and other explosive weapons (including hand grenade, land and naval mines, mortar, rockets, unmanned systems (aerial, ground, surface and underwater vehicles controlled remotely or operating autonomously using advanced software and sensors) able to perform guided strikes (including attack or kamikaze drones, FPV loitering munitions), torpedoes), or parts thereof, contributing to replenishment of stocks. →Scope: This topic aims to follow up and complement previous activities for the development of an endo-atmospheric interceptor by maturing key technologies required to successfully counter hypersonic and ballistic threats up to TRL 6. It should build on specific concept designs and advance the required technologies by developing dedicated demonstrators, e.g. for airframe, propulsion, platform separation, lethality, threat tracking and acquisition. →Scope: The high speed and significant manoeuvrability of hypersonic vehicles, particularly hypersonic glide vehicles, create difficult conditions for target detection and tracking, which are exacerbated by changes in radar cross section characteristics. Radar waveforms and signal processing become essential to counter the effects induced by hypersonic threat dynamics. In addition, the last decade has seen a global increase in the use of unmanned aerial vehicles (UAVs) for battlefield intelligence gathering and reconnaissance. Anti-UAV radars therefore need to be developed to detect, identify and track such systems. Innovative approaches (e.g. AI and cognitive methods) can provide the means to select the best waveform receiver filter combination to maximise radar detection and tracking performance also using a feedback loop between the received and transmitted signal characteristics.
